Specifications
| Parameter | Specification |
|---|---|
| Product Name | Proximity Probe |
| Brand | Bently Nevada |
| Product Series | 3300 XL 8 mm Proximity Transducer System |
| Model Number | 330710-000-060-10-02-00 |
| Probe Type | Standard Proximity Probe |
| Sensing Technology | Non-contact Eddy Current Measurement |
| Probe Diameter | 8 mm |
| Thread Configuration | Standard threaded probe body |
| Unthreaded Length | 0 mm |
| Probe Case Length | 60 mm |
| Cable Length Code | 10 |
| Supplied Cable Length | 1.0 meter (3.3 ft) |
| Connector Option | Standard Connector Configuration |
| Output Function | Shaft vibration and displacement sensing |
| Measurement Capability | Radial vibration, axial position, shaft movement monitoring |
| System Compatibility | Bently Nevada 3300 XL 8 mm Proximity Transducer Systems |
| Compatible Components | Proximitor Sensor and Extension Cable assemblies |
| Installation Method | Direct mounting on rotating machinery monitoring points |
| Signal Type | Dynamic vibration and static position measurement signals |
| Operating Principle | Electromagnetic eddy current sensing without physical shaft contact |
| Monitoring Applications | Vibration monitoring, thrust position, shaft displacement analysis |
| Environmental Use | Industrial machinery and harsh operating environments |
| Typical Machine Assets | Turbines, compressors, pumps, motors, generators |
| Industry Applications | Power generation, oil & gas, petrochemical, manufacturing, mining |
| Integration Role | Front-end sensing component within machinery protection systems |
| Maintenance Requirement | Periodic inspection of mounting position, connector condition, and cable routing |
| Reliability Advantage | Stable signal integrity for long-term condition monitoring programs |
